Automatic taps, automatic soap dispensers, sensors on urinals and automatic lighting are increasingly being used in commercial sanitary facilities. They are absolutely necessary to reduce energy and water consumption on the one hand, but now also to minimize the risk of contamination. These technologies, which will increase with the advent of IoT, are already a new focus for maintenance teams today. Special attention

Communal showers and changing rooms can quickly become a source of mold and bacteria build-up from the humidity. Regular cleaning is rarely sufficient. Special attention to floors and walls is also necessary. Q3-Facilities treats these floors and walls with special products based on nano-technology, making them dirt and water repellent.
